OpenGL渲染纹理和平面反射编程
在本文中,我们将探讨如何使用OpenGL编程实现纹理渲染和平面反射效果。我们将使用C++语言编写示例代码,并利用OpenGL库进行图形渲染。
纹理渲染是指将图像贴到物体表面以实现更逼真的渲染效果。平面反射是一种模拟镜面反射的技术,可以在物体表面呈现出反射环境的效果。
首先,我们需要设置OpenGL环境并创建一个窗口用于显示渲染结果。下面是一个简单的OpenGL初始化函数:
#include <GL/glut.h>
void init()
{
glClearColor(
本文通过C++和OpenGL库展示了如何实现纹理渲染和平面反射效果。首先介绍OpenGL环境初始化和窗口创建,接着讲解如何加载并绑定纹理图像,再通过绘制四边形并设置纹理坐标实现平面反射。虽然示例代码简单,但为更复杂的真实感渲染奠定了基础。
订阅专栏 解锁全文
210

被折叠的 条评论
为什么被折叠?



